The increasing deployment of unmanned systems and AI-driven weaponry on Ukraine’s front lines is fundamentally altering modern warfare, signaling potential shifts in defense procurement and investment priorities. While machines now handle more combat roles, human troops remain critical for territorial defense, underscoring a balanced approach to military modernization.

- Rising Role of Unmanned Systems: The conflict has accelerated the deployment of drones and robotic platforms for reconnaissance, logistics, and direct fire missions, potentially expanding the addressable market for defense firms specializing in these technologies.
- Human Troops Remain Critical: Despite automation, territorial defense still requires human judgment and physical presence, suggesting that demand for traditional infantry equipment and training may not decline sharply.
- Shift in Defense Spending Priorities: Budgets could tilt toward AI, sensors, and counter-drone capabilities, while legacy platforms like manned armored vehicles may see reduced procurement.
- Geopolitical Implications: The demonstrated effectiveness of these systems in Ukraine may encourage other nations to accelerate their own modernization programs, creating long-term headwinds for defense exporters.
- New Vulnerabilities: Reliance on electronic systems and data links introduces risks from jamming and cyberattacks, potentially spurring investment in hardened communications and electronic warfare solutions.
- Supply Chain Opportunities: The need for rapid production of drones and munitions may benefit companies with scalable manufacturing and modular system designs.

Recent reporting from the BBC highlights how the front line—described as a "kill-zone"—has become a testing ground for next-generation military technology. Drones, autonomous ground vehicles, and AI-assisted targeting systems are increasingly taking on roles once performed exclusively by soldiers, reducing direct human exposure to enemy fire. However, the same report emphasizes that despite this technological leap, infantry and specialized personnel are still indispensable for holding ground and conducting complex operations.
This transformation has accelerated in recent weeks as both sides in the conflict adapt to a rapidly evolving battlefield. The integration of new weapons has made engagements faster and more lethal, compressing decision-making timelines and driving demand for real-time data processing. For defense contractors, this trend suggests a sustained focus on unmanned systems, electronic warfare, and networked command platforms.
The BBC’s reporting notes that while machines reduce casualties, they also create new vulnerabilities—such as reliance on communications links and susceptibility to electronic jamming. This duality is shaping how militaries and their suppliers approach the balance between autonomy and human oversight.

Market observers suggest that the ongoing evolution of warfare in Ukraine offers a real-world laboratory for assessing the effectiveness of autonomous and semi-autonomous systems. The trend may lead to increased research and development spending by defense ministries worldwide, particularly in the realms of artificial intelligence, machine vision, and loitering munitions.
However, the transition is unlikely to be seamless. Ethical concerns regarding autonomous lethal decision-making, as well as regulatory frameworks at the international level, could moderate adoption rates. Furthermore, the continued reliance on human soldiers for complex ground operations implies that demand for traditional equipment—such as body armor, small arms, and medical supplies—will persist.
From an investment perspective, companies with diversified portfolios spanning both unmanned platforms and human-soldier systems may be better positioned to navigate this dual-track evolution. Yet caution is warranted: the pace of technological change and shifting geopolitical alliances could alter procurement cycles unpredictably. No specific stock recommendations or price targets are implied; rather, the sector appears to be entering a period of structural change that invites careful monitoring of technological adoption trends and government budget announcements.
